Ask any round-the-world sailor and they will quickly tell you the stormiest seas, stirred by the strongest winds, are found in the Southern Ocean. These infamously rough latitudes are labelled the "roaring 40s", "furious 50s" and "screaming 60s". ”
The Southern Ocean not the Southern Hemisphere
Main reason: This region has the longest stretches of open water. The longer the stretches on open water are, the greater surface wind force can build up, the longer is the fetch, the higher the waves.
Surface Winds (measured in 10m hight) have no direct connection to high altitude wind systems or Jet Streams. Ok, an influence on the general weather cannot be denied.

On the "usual FE map" I believe simple map scaling indicates that Sydney to Santiago is over 25,000 km.
A typical QANTAS flight QF27 takes roughly 12 hours (sometimes less). That would make the plane's average ground-speed about 2080 km/hr. Since the cruising speed of a B747-400 is 933 km/h that would require a tail-wind of about 1150 km/hr.

That seems way above any wind speed observed anywhere. Any comments?

Re: Australia & Chile FET how far apart?
« Reply #65 on: November 08, 2018, 12:43:30 PM »
On the "usual FE map" I believe simple map scaling indicates that Sydney to Santiago is over 25,000 km.
Your belief is wrong.

There are exactly the same amount of lines of longitude depicted on the AE map as there are on the Mercator.
True, but that is not the main issue. The spacing between those longitude lines is also extremely important:
  • on the Globe, starts at zero (km/degree) at the North Pole, reaches a maximum (of 111 km/deg) on the Equator and drops to zero again at the South Pole,

  • on the Mercator Projection, stays constant at all latitudes (but the scale of that projection is known to be correct only at the equator) and
  • on the AE map starts from zero (km/deg) at the North Pole increases to about 175 km/deg at the Equator and finally to 349 km/deg around the "rim".[/li
If you want to check on my "Sydney to Santiago is over 25,000 km" just scale it off an AEP map, such as Gleason's.
